How to Choose an Asbestos Attorney for Your Mesothelioma Case

Mesothelioma, a horrible disease caused by asbestos, is a result of exposure to asbestos. It was used in many buildings before companies began to cover up the dangers.

A mesothelioma lawyer can assist families and patients receive compensation through asbestos trust funds. When selecting an attorney for victims, they must consider the following:

Find a firm that practices Nationwide

When deciding on an asbestos lawyer to represent you, it's recommended to choose a lawyer who is specialized in mesothelioma and has experience handling national cases. Mesothelioma lawyers at national firms typically have a network of attorneys across the country. They are able to more quickly determine the time, place you were exposed to asbestos. They also have access to specialized resources like asbestos product databases as well as historical cases. Additionally, nationwide companies have the advantage of having worked with numerous local courts, which allows them to create substantial lawsuits that are swiftly processed through the legal system.

A mesothelioma law firm must be licensed to practice in your state and have a solid understanding of the laws of your state. Mesothelioma lawsuits are typically filed in multiple states, and each state's laws vary. A nationwide firm can offer the benefit of knowing all the laws and regulations of every state, including the complex statutes.

It is important to choose an attorney who is experienced in dealing with cases of victims from various backgrounds. Mesothelioma patients come from a variety of industries and have different experiences. A mesothelioma lawyer can assist victims determine the best legal strategy to obtain the compensation they deserve.

It is essential to find an asbestos attorney who is aware of the mesothelioma effects on the victims and their families. Attorneys must be compassionate and empathic towards their clients and be willing to listen to concerns or questions. They should be able to explain complex legal concepts in simple terms.

The best mesothelioma lawyers have years of fighting for asbestos victims and their families. They are able to identify potential liability parties (such as asbestos manufacturers or insurers) and negotiate a settlement with them in order to obtain the compensation you need. In addition, they must be aware of the mesothelioma effects on victims and their families, and are prepared to fight for the compensation that they are entitled to.

Seek out Experience

When looking for a mesothelioma lawyer, be sure to find one with a lot of experience and a solid track record. Visit their website to learn how they've been in business for, and what kinds of cases they've handled. You can also request references from previous clients as well as community groups.

Mesothelioma is a complicated disease that requires extensive knowledge of asbestos litigation. Professionally trained lawyers can ensure that you get the compensation you are entitled to. They will be able to calculate the value of your claim and will ensure that you receive a sum that covers both past and future damages.

An experienced lawyer can also help you identify possible sources of exposure. This is important because it can be difficult to determine the source and time you were exposed. They will examine your past work experience and look for connections with other asbestos-related victims. They also have the resources to hire experts like industrial hygienists and medical professionals.

Another thing an experienced mesothelioma lawyer can accomplish is to bring a lawsuit on your behalf before the legal deadlines. They'll also be able to tell you which state laws give the greatest chance of receiving compensation. They can also make an application for VA benefits or trust fund claims, if required.

Many of the companies responsible for asbestos exposure have gone bankrupt. Companies that deal with asbestos often declare bankruptcy to avoid being sued by mesothelioma patients. Many victims did not receive compensation as a result of this. A mesothelioma attorney can assist victims in receiving compensation from trust funds put by these companies.

Veterans who were exposed Asbestos Lawsuit while serving in the military may be eligible to receive compensation from the Department of Veterans Affairs. A mesothelioma lawyer can help victims file VA mesothelioma lawsuits and lawsuits against their former employers. They can also help veterans qualify for VA pension and health benefits they did not receive. This will help to ensure that veterans and their family members are properly cared for when they suffer from asbestos-related illnesses.

Find a firm that Works on a Contingency Basis

In addition to locating the best lawyer for your situation You should also find a lawyer that works on a contingency basis. This means that your lawyer will be able to meet your needs first and do all they can to secure the amount you are due. If your lawyer loses your case there will be no charges. This arrangement puts your interest first and can help obtain the mesothelioma settlement that you deserve.

Mesothelioma lawyers have access to resources many other attorneys don't have access to such as asbestos databases and experts. They also know how to properly investigate a mesothelioma claim and that includes determining a victim's work history and linking it to potential exposure events that could have occurred years ago.

In addition, a knowledgeable mesothelioma lawyer can help to determine the best kind of legal action for their client. There are four main mesothelioma types which include personal injury lawsuits wrongful death lawsuits, asbestos case trust fund claims, and mesothelioma VA claims. Personal injury lawsuits are filed by the victims of mesothelioma as well as their surviving family members to receive financial compensation from the companies responsible for their asbestos exposure. Family members of those who died because of asbestos exposure have filed lawsuits for wrongful deaths on behalf of their estate.

Asbestos trusts are formed by asbestos-related companies who have been bankrupted or dissolved to pay claims for asbestos-related diseases. Settlements or jury awards are generally used to resolve these claims. In addition, mesothelioma VA benefits are available to military veterans who have been diagnosed with an asbestos-related disease such as mesothelioma.

It is important to hire mesothelioma attorneys immediately in the event that you have been exposed to asbestos case. Asbestos lawyers have the connections and experience to employ mesothelioma experts like industrial hygienists or medical experts. They will also be able to file your lawsuit with the appropriate court jurisdiction. In addition, they'll be able to spot any procedural errors that could undermine your case and hinder you from receiving the compensation you are entitled to.

Find a firm that Offers an Evaluation of Cases for Free

An asbestos lawyer with experience in asbestos law can help you recover compensation if you or someone you have loved has been diagnosed with asbestos-related illness like mesothelioma. Compensation could be derived from an asbestos firm or a fund for victims established, as well as an insurance company.

Find a mesothelioma attorney who offers a free assessment of your case. This will allow you to make an informed decision regarding legal representation. Once you have a brief list of potential lawyers take them to an interview and be aware of their communication and responsiveness. Also, ensure that you have a clear understanding of their fees and if any other charges may be associated with your case.

A mesothelioma lawyer who knows the law can defend your legal rights and ensure you get the maximum amount of compensation. They can help you determine the best type of claim to file and which companies are liable. They can also explain the litigation process and how to negotiate an agreement.

Asbestos lawyers can work on a contingent basis which means that they only get paid if they succeed in winning the case. This is a far better option than hiring an attorney on an hourly basis, and could save you money.

Many asbestos lawsuits are settled outside of court, however certain cases go to trial, which can result in substantial verdicts. A reputable New York team of mesothelioma lawyers has extensive trial experience, which helps them obtain more substantial settlements.

Moreover, New York attorneys have extensive networks and connections to the top mesothelioma experts and researchers. This can greatly enhance the quality of your case.

New York mesothelioma patients can benefit from a mesothelioma lawyer with years of experience and proven results in asbestos-related cases. These types of attorneys are able to secure multi-million dollars settlements for their clients and get six-figure compensation from asbestos trust funds.

Veterans who were exposed in a variety of states to asbestos may be eligible for compensation. Compensation could include disability benefits from the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s, payments from a veterans disability fund, and compensation from asbestos-related businesses through a personal injury lawsuit.
